Conflicts Reveal Old Patterns
- Conflicts often reveal old patterns: ask 'what did that bring up in me?' instead of only blaming the other person.
- Noticing triggers uncovers unmet needs like wanting to be heard.
Ask For A Therapist Who Pushes You
- Call out your tendency to give polished answers and ask the therapist to push you deeper during the first session.
- Ask therapists directly for the style you need: more challenging or more supportive.
